Evolution of Healthcare Systems

Historical Perspective

The journey of modern healthcare is marked by significant milestones, transitioning from traditional, community-based practices to sophisticated, technology-driven systems. Early healthcare relied heavily on local knowledge, herbal remedies, and rudimentary surgical techniques. The advent of germ theory in the 19th century revolutionized medicine, leading to breakthroughs such as vaccines and antibiotics. The 20th century witnessed the rise of institutionalized healthcare, insurance models, and public health initiatives that laid the groundwork for today’s advanced systems.

Technological Innovations in Modern Healthcare

Digital Health Records

Implementing Electronic Health Records (EHRs) has transformed how patient data is stored, accessed, and shared. EHRs improve accuracy, reduce errors, and facilitate seamless communication among healthcare providers. They also enable data-driven decision-making, enhancing the quality of care. Countries leveraging interoperable EHR systems exemplify progress toward integrated modern healthcare.

Telemedicine and Telehealth

Telemedicine has expanded access to healthcare through remote consultations, diagnostics, and follow-up care. It is especially impactful in rural and underserved areas, where medical facilities are scarce. By reducing travel time and costs, telehealth bridges gaps in healthcare delivery, ensuring timely interventions and ongoing patient support.

Artificial Intelligence and Machine Learning

AI-powered diagnostics and treatment planning are revolutionizing modern healthcare. Machine learning algorithms can analyze vast datasets to detect diseases early, predict patient outcomes, and suggest personalized treatments. These technologies assist healthcare professionals in making more accurate decisions, ultimately leading to better patient care.

Wearable Devices and IoT

Wearables and the Internet of Things (IoT) enable continuous monitoring of vital signs like heart rate, blood pressure, and oxygen saturation. These devices facilitate preventive care by providing real-time data for early intervention. Patients can actively participate in managing their health, leading to improved outcomes and reduced hospital admissions.

Robotics and Automation

Robotic systems are increasingly used in surgeries, offering high precision and minimally invasive procedures. Automated hospital processes streamline administrative tasks, reduce human error, and improve patient throughput. Examples include robotic pharmacists and autonomous ambulance vehicles, contributing to efficient healthcare delivery.

Personalized Medicine

Advances in genetic testing and pharmacogenomics allow treatments to be tailored to individual genetic profiles. Personalized medicine improves efficacy, reduces adverse effects, and supports early diagnosis. For example, targeted cancer therapies demonstrate how genomic insights can revolutionize treatment approaches.

Data Privacy and Security Regulations

Protecting patient data is paramount in modern healthcare. Regulations like HIPAA in the US and GDPR in Europe set standards for confidentiality and security. Implementing robust cybersecurity measures ensures trust and compliance as data become central to healthcare delivery.
